欢迎您访问 最编程 本站为您分享编程语言代码,编程技术文章!
您现在的位置是: 首页

Git笔记

最编程 2024-05-01 09:42:46
...

一、提交代码

1、git init

2、 git status

3、git add .

4、git commit -m 'init'

5、创建远程仓库

6、git  remote add origin  url//这边的URL跟的是你项目的地址

7、git push -u origin  master

二、git基本理论

Git本地有三个工作区域:工作目录(Working Directory)、暂存区(Stage/Index)、资源库(Repository或Git Directory)。如果在加上远程的git仓库(Remote Directory)就可以分为四个工作区域。文件在这四个区域之间的转换关系如下: 

  • Workspace:工作区,就是你平时存放项目代码的地方

  • Index / Stage:暂存区,用于临时存放你的改动,事实上它只是一个文件,保存即将提交到文件列表信息

  • Repository:仓库区(或本地仓库),就是安全存放数据的位置,这里面有你提交到所有版本的数据。其中HEAD指向最新放入仓库的版本

  • Remote:远程仓库,托管代码的服务器,可以简单的认为是你项目组中的一台电脑用于远程数据交换

三、git的工作流程 

1、在工作目录中添加、修改文件;

2、将需要进行版本管理的文件放入暂存区域;

3、将暂存区域的文件提交到git仓库。

四、创建分支、合并分支

1. Idea创建分支

git和idea集成,创建一个dev分支,在dev分支创建一个类,添加代码,并且提交,最后合并到master分支

创建分支

分支命名 

在分支中创建类 

分支commit  push 

gitee 仓库中查看

 切换到master

 

合并分支 

可看到分支添加的类

在master再push一下到gitee仓库 

master成功push到gitee 

2. 文件夹创建、合并分支

  • 创建分支:git branch dev
  • 切换分支:git checkout dev 或 git switch master
  • 创建并切换到分支:git checkout -b dev 或 git switch -c dev
  • 查看当前分支:git branch
  • 合并分支:git merge dev
  • 删除分支:git branch -d dev
  • 列出所有远程分支:git branch -r
  • 删除远程分支:git push origin --delete [branch-name]  或 git branch -dr [remote/branch]

创建文件夹以及readme.txt(要先add commit)

 

创建分支

修改分支内容 

 add commit 分支dev

切换到master

合并分支 

 

五、 设置SSH公钥,实现免密码登录

使用命令在.ssh创建文件

复制秘钥 

设置成功

六、idea与git集成

idea新建项目 

 

 

克隆到本地项目

 

idea中敲git命令 

测试 

测试--1

测试--2

测试--3

测试--4